Obit posted in Ottumwa Courier September 23, 1943
Mrs. Elsie E. Lathrop, 54, resident of Ottumwa for the past 35 years, died at 7:15 p.m. Thursday at the home of her nephew W.H. Millard, 509 North Madison avenue. She was the daughter of John W. and Malinda Sales and was born in Davis county April 14, 1889. She was a member of the Christian church south of Blakesburg. She was married to Frank Lathrop May 25, 1908 who preceded her in death September 20, 1940. She also was preceded in death by an infant daughter, her father, a brother and a sister. Survivors include two sons, Harvey H. Lathrop with the Navy overseas, and Ralph L. Lathrop, Madison, Wisconsin; three grandchildren; her mother , Mrs. Malinda Sales, Ottumwa; two sisters, Mrs. Lizzie Hartley and Mrs. Mayme Hasting, both of Ottumwa, and six brothers, Walter J., John, Frank and George Sales all of Ottumwa, and Harry A. Sales Danville, Illinois, and William R. Sales Hammond, Indianan. The body is at the Johnson funeral chapel awaiting completion of arrangements. Short funeral services for Mrs. Elsie Lathrop who died Thursday evening at the home of her nephew, W.H. Millard of 309 North Madison avenue, will be held at 2 p.m. Sunday from the Johnson funeral chapel, and at 2:30 from the Pentecostal Church of God on Church street. The Rev. A.D. McClure will be in charge and burial will be in Shaul cemetery. The pall bearers will be Wilbur Shields, Claude Albright, William Bray, Burl Finley, Louis Finley and Henry Suechting.
